如何应对域迁移中的架构主机不可更改问题 (做域迁移时 无法更改架构主机)

随着公司规模的逐渐扩大,为了更好地维护数据安全,提高业务效率,许多公司开始考虑将自己的应用迁移到公有云平台上。而在进行应用迁移的过程中,域迁移是必不可少的一步。域迁移不仅可以保证原有的业务数据的完整性,同时也可以让公司将数据的管理更加集中和规范化。然而,在域迁移的过程中,架构主机不可更改问题是需要重点关注的。本文将从如何应对架构主机不可更改问题进行详细阐述。

一、什么是架构主机不可更改问题

在进行域迁移时,由于许多应用是基于特定的主机(如IP地址、主机名等)开发和部署的,而这些主机信息在迁移后可能会发生改变,这就是架构主机不可更改问题。如果不解决这个问题,那么在应用迁移后,会出现一系列的问题,比如无法访问数据库、无法获取配置等等。因此,如何解决架构主机不可更改问题是域迁移过程中需要考虑的重点问题之一。

二、如何应对架构主机不可更改问题

1.尽量减少主机信息的硬编码

在设计和开发应用的过程中,尽量避免在代码中硬编码主机信息,而是应将这些信息保存在配置文件中,这样可以使得应用在迁移后更加灵活和适应各种不同的环境。同时,在进行迁移前,也需要对配置文件进行仔细的修改和检查,以确保其中的主机信息是最新和正确的。

2.使用服务发现机制

在进行迁移时,可以考虑使用服务发现机制来解决架构主机不可更改的问题。服务发现机制可以将所有应用在部署时注册到服务中心,通过服务中心统一管理和分配资源,在迁移后可以减少信息硬编码的问题。使用服务发现机制后,在进行迁移时,只需要修改服务中心的地址,应用就可以在新的环境中运行。

3.适当调整应用设计和架构

在一些特殊情况下,适当调整应用设计和架构也可以帮助解决架构主机不可更改的问题。比如,在为应用分配主机时,可以使用动态主机分配的方式,将应用部署在符合标准的云平台上,这样可以在迁移后,根据需求进行灵活的调整和分配。

4.进行适当的测试

在进行迁移时,需要对所有的代码、配置文件、数据库等进行仔细的检查和测试。在测试过程中,需要检查所有的服务是否可以正常访问,以及能否正确获取配置、数据等信息。如果发现异常,要尽快定位问题,进行重新部署和修复。

5.备份重要数据

在进行迁移时,一定要备份所有重要的数据,以保证在出现异常情况时,可以快速进行恢复和修复,避免出现损失。

三、

架构主机不可更改问题在进行域迁移时是必须解决的一个问题。在解决问题的时候,要尽量避免硬编码、采用服务发现机制、适当调整应用设计和架构、进行适当的测试和备份重要数据。通过这些措施,可以保证应用在迁移后的正常运行,使得企业能够更好地管理和维护业务数据。


数据运维技术 » 如何应对域迁移中的架构主机不可更改问题 (做域迁移时 无法更改架构主机)